About the role
International Justice Mission ( IJM ) is the global leader in protecting vulnerable people from violence around the world. Our team of over 1, 2 00 professionals are at work worldwide in over 3 0 offices. Together we are on a mission to rescue millions, protect half a billion, and make justice unstoppable. We are a global community that cares for one another. We believe that the way we work is as important as the results we achieve. We provide professional excellence with joy and celebration to all those we serve. The Need For over 25 years, IJM has pioneered the work to protect vulnerable people from violence. 9 out of 9 times in the last decade, IJM's Justice System Strengthening Projects have reduced slavery and violence between 50 and 85% for very large populations of people in poverty. As we grow to expand our impact to protec t 500 million people from violence , we are seeking a Regional HR Director. The Regional HR Director plays a pivotal role in enhancing organizational effectiveness by partnering closely with regional and global leaders to align HR strategies with IJM's mission and priorities. This role is strategic and innovative, supporting business growth and talent acquisition and development in complex, matrixed environments, and embedding a culture of agility, data-driven decision-making, and strategic partnership. The Regional HR Director collaborates closely with regional leadership, including the Regional President and management teams, as well as Global People Support (GPS), to ensure adherence to global standards and effective regional alignment. In addition, the Regional HR Director incorporates regional and local adaptation to address specific labor laws, cultural contexts, and emerging business needs. Working in a matrixed environment, this role fosters collaboration with Country Directors and local HR teams. This position is based in London, UK, and reports to the Regional Vice President of Strategy and Operations for Africa and Europe and is only available for candidates with the right to work in the U K .
Responsibilities
- Strategy & Knowledge Development & Implementation
- Actively participate in regional leadership team strategic planning, contributing HR insights that drive organizational objectives .
- Develop and monitor regional HR policies, ensuring compliance with enterprise standards and labor laws through regular auditing and timely corrective actions.
- Lead regional implementation of global HR systems, tools and processes (salary annual reviews, annual performance reviews, employee engagement, etc. ) facilitating continuous compliance reviews and identifying future needs to enhance effectiveness
- Develop and maintain partnerships with external HR vendors and service providers to support regional HR operations.
- Mentor and coach regional and country HR leaders and teams to enhance HR capacity and effectiveness.
- Networking & Partnership
- Build and sustain strategic HR partnerships with regional leadership, line managers, and cross-functional teams.
- Champion spiritual formation initiatives and nurture an inclusive and motivating work environment aligned with IJM's values.
- Regularly engage with employees, interns, and fellows to encourage their development, well-being, and engagement.
- Policies and Procedures
- Proactively review and recommend improvements to HR policies, procedures, compensation, benefits, and practices to enhance compliance, contextualization , socialization and awareness, engagement, and alignment with global standards.
- Collaborate with GPS to align regional HR best practices within the global framework.
- Apply deep knowledge of employment law and risk management.
- Communication and Employee Relations
- Provide expert guidance on regional complex employee relations issues, equipping managers to navigate sensitive matters successfully.
- Ensure that communications and change management initiatives maintain a people-centric focus, effectively supporting the needs of leadership and teams.
- Lead compliant employee relations practices through transparent and fair policies, processes and procedures that mitigate risk and enhance employee experience and trust .
- Have a deep understanding of disciplinary, capability, misconduct, investigation policies, procedures and lead teams in fair and effective delivery.
- Recruitment and Reward
- Lead the HR team to deliver the talent pipeline in collaboration with country leaders and aligned to the regional budget, recruitment and equal opportunity policies and engagement with technical platform solutions e.g. Workday recruitment module ATS.
- Champion safe recruitment practices that mitigate risk to the organization and its stakeholders and ensure background checks are legal and complete.
